Every SAF Pathway Begins with a Feedstock

No matter how advanced the production technology becomes, every SAF pathway starts with a raw material.

For today's commercial production, that often means used cooking oil (UCO), animal fats, vegetable oils, or waste oils processed through the HEFA pathway.

But the market is expanding rapidly to include multiple other feedstock sources:

  • Waste Ethanol

  • Crop Ethanol

  • e-Methanol

  • Renewable Hydrogen

  • Municipal Waste

  • Biomass

  • Other Alternative Inputs

Feedstocks Have Become Global Commodities

One of the largest shifts in recent years reveals that feedstocks are no longer local markets.

  • Used cooking oil collected in Asia may ultimately help produce renewable fuels in Europe.

  • Animal fats from North America can influence renewable diesel margins on other continents.

  • Waste ethanol values may change because of developments occurring thousands of miles away.

In short, the market has become more deeply interconnected than ever before.

Our latest SAF Snapshot illustrates this clearly. Chinese SAF exports continue to rise as European buyers secure growing volumes.

Meanwhile, market participants report that many Chinese producers are already contracted through the end of the year. This leaves far less supply available for spot purchases.

Those trade flows don't simply affect finished fuel. They also reshape competition for the feedstocks needed to produce it.

Feedstock Markets Are Increasingly Competitive

As more industries pursue low-carbon fuels, they're often competing for the same limited pool of renewable feedstocks.

  • Renewable Diesel Producers

  • SAF Producers

  • Marine Biofuel Suppliers

  • Renewable Chemicals

In many cases, they're all looking for similar waste-based oils and fats. That competition can tighten supply, increase prices, and quickly alter production economics.

Recent market movements underscore this point. During May, several key waste-based feedstocks continued to strengthen. US markets led gains, with tallow and UCO values increasing across multiple regions.

These changes may appear modest in isolation. But for producers operating at commercial scale, relatively small changes in feedstock costs can have a significant impact on margins.

Not All Feedstocks Are Moving Together

Another misconception is that feedstocks always behave as a single market. In short, they don’t.

  • Used cooking oil may strengthen while vegetable oils soften.

  • Waste ethanol can outperform HEFA economics.

  • Animal fats may respond to completely different supply dynamics than agricultural oils.

The SAF Snapshot highlights this growing divergence, showing different modeled economics across Crop Ethanol ATJ, Waste Ethanol ATJ, HEFA SAF, eSAF, and E-Methanol ATJ pathways.

Each solution responds to its own combination of feedstock costs, renewable electricity, hydrogen prices, and policy incentives.

For market participants, that creates opportunity. Rather than relying on a single production pathway, companies can continually evaluate which feedstocks and technologies offer the strongest economics under changing market conditions.

Feedstocks Are Becoming Strategic Assets

The evolution of feedstock markets is changing how companies think about procurement.

Historically, feedstocks were often viewed as production inputs to be sourced as efficiently as possible. Today, they are becoming strategic assets.

Securing long-term access to reliable, low-carbon feedstocks can provide a competitive advantage that extends well beyond procurement. It can influence:

  • Production Costs

  • Carbon Intensity Scores

  • Regulatory Eligibility

  • Margin Performance

  • Long-Term Investment Decisions

As governments expand SAF mandates around the world, those advantages become increasingly valuable.

Market Intelligence Begins Upstream

One of the clearest lessons emerging from today's SAF market is that downstream fuel prices rarely tell the whole story. By the time finished fuel prices begin to move, feedstock markets have often been shifting for weeks or months.

  • Changes in UCO Availability

  • Shifting Export Flows

  • Regional Tallow Markets

  • Renewable Hydrogen Pricing

  • Waste Ethanol Supply

Each can provide an early indication of where SAF economics may be heading. That's why many market participants spend as much time monitoring feedstocks as they do watching finished fuel prices.
